They kind of HAD to for this one though, they built it up to be all hands on deck prevent the end of the world...again...you couldn't just have him assassinated in the background and everyone goes away after that.

 

Soooooorta. She's the one who takes over leading the Avengers after Cap has...multiple issues...like dying, turning bad etc. in the comics. So if anyone was going to show up and be close to his level it had to be her, to give them a real powerhouse to replace some of the outgoing people.

 

You have to watch the new Spiderman: Far From Home...that directly follows the end of Endgame and addresses the 5 year "blip" they call it, and how people are trying to cash in with Iron Man and Cap gone now.

 

Yeah...I get what you mean there...I mean we all knew that the whole half the universe was going to be undone, but some of the deaths should have been for real, and undoing that much of it was a little weak. Vision dying was pretty much the only one that doesn't get undone.

 

I mean your only real choices there are the original 7, and two of them did die. Who else do you kill off? Hawkeye everyone expected, so they teased it constantly. Hulk and Thor have to be close to immortal. Cap you could have/should have, but giving him his back in time happy ending wasn't a terrible send off either. Still out of the picture, but without the predictable sacrificial death.
